Cohort Disciplines

The Fulbright Visiting Scholar Program for Iraq will offer a total of five cohorts with one for each of the following disciplines:

  • American Literature

  • Engineering: Mechanical, computer, civil, chemical, electrical, industrial, materials, & systems engineering.

  • Political Science

  • Science and Technology: Biology, chemistry, physics, mathematics, computer science, information science, and GIS.

  • TEFL / Applied Linguistics: Applied linguistics and teaching of English as a foreign or second language.

The Fulbright Program, sponsored by the U.S. Department of State’s Bureau of Educational and Cultural Affairs, is the U.S. government’s flagship international exchange program and is supported by the people of the United States and partner countries around the world. For more information, visit fulbright.state.gov.

The Fulbright Scholar Program is administered by CIES, a division of the Institute of International Education.
